Valero Energy Corp. has announced plans to eliminate 237 positions at its Benicia refinery as it prepares to wind down operations at the facility, one of the last fuel-making plants in California. In a letter to state employment regulators and local officials, the company said it expects the closure to be permanent, with layoffs taking place from March 15 through July 1. The impacted employees are not represented by a union and make up most of the refinery’s 348-person workforce.
